Output 42e9737c65cfdccbf3d6be484240f3dfe064c6a14b2ed292e3bf851304c47a3b:436

value
16412
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f51ad33fbbc83a8b6d2e28e90aa2170e33af5114 OP_EQUAL
address
3Q31cPXRNAkSWsY2xLXNbivZ2LdJMAxg4P
transaction
42e9737c65cfdccbf3d6be484240f3dfe064c6a14b2ed292e3bf851304c47a3b
confirmations
508165
spent
true